code to calculate (betasw,beta90sw,bsw) as a function of (lambda,tc,theta,s,delta) where lambda (nm): wavelength tc: temperauter in degree celsius, must be a scalar s: salinity, must be scalar delta: depolarization ratio, if not provided, default = 0.039 will be used. betasw: volume scattering at angles defined by theta. its size is [x y], where x is the number of angles (x = length(theta)) and y is the number of wavelengths in lambda (y = length(lambda)) beta90sw: volume scattering at 90 degree. its size is [1 y] bw: total scattering coefficient. its size is [1 y] for backscattering coefficients, divide total scattering by 2
